Moodle APIs 4.3
Moodle 4.3.6 (Build: 20240812)
core_h5p\api Member List

This is the complete list of members for core_h5p\api, including all inherited members.

can_access_pluginfile_hash(string $url, bool $preventredirect=true)core_h5p\apiprotectedstatic
can_edit_content(\stored_file $file)core_h5p\apistatic
create_content_from_pluginfile_url(string $url, stdClass $config, factory $factory, stdClass &$messages, bool $preventredirect=true, bool $skipcapcheck=false)core_h5p\apistatic
delete_content(\stdClass $content, factory $factory)core_h5p\apistatic
delete_content_from_pluginfile_url(string $url, factory $factory)core_h5p\apistatic
delete_library(factory $factory, stdClass $library)core_h5p\apistatic
get_content_from_pathnamehash(string $pathnamehash)core_h5p\apistatic
get_content_from_pluginfile_url(string $url, bool $preventredirect=true, bool $skipcapcheck=false)core_h5p\apistatic
get_contenttype_libraries(?string $fields='')core_h5p\apistatic
get_dependent_libraries(int $libraryid)core_h5p\apistatic
get_export_info_from_context_id(int $contextid, factory $factory, string $component, string $filearea)core_h5p\apistatic
get_library(int $libraryid)core_h5p\apistatic
get_library_details(array $params, bool $configurable, string $fields='')core_h5p\apistatic
get_original_content_from_pluginfile_url(string $url, bool $preventredirect=true, bool $skipcapcheck=false)core_h5p\apistatic
get_pluginfile_hash(string $url)core_h5p\apiprotectedstatic
is_library_enabled(\stdClass $librarydata)core_h5p\apistatic
is_valid_package(\stored_file $file, bool $onlyupdatelibs, bool $skipcontent=false, ?factory $factory=null, bool $deletefiletree=true)core_h5p\apistatic
set_library_enabled(int $libraryid, bool $isenabled)core_h5p\apistatic